Mutation of the histidin residue of the DRH motif in vasopressin V2 receptor expression and function
BACKGROUND AND THE PURPOSE OF THE STUDY: Vasopressin type 2 receptor (V2R), a G protein coupled receptor (GPCR), plays an important role in the regulation of renal antidiuretic function.
